Output 3a63d43c74d20defe98a464b95853f65772ae909486bec1ad91057338f04ad37:26

value
27032692
script pubkey
OP_0 OP_PUSHBYTES_20 d60a5fd16766fda251519b2dd49ea4fc3ae02916
address
bc1q6c99l5t8vm76y523nvkaf84ylsawq2gkllq7qn
transaction
3a63d43c74d20defe98a464b95853f65772ae909486bec1ad91057338f04ad37